Caregiver Full-time
Right at Home Marin

Personal Care Caregiver

$22 - $30 / hour

Salary: $22 - $30/per hour

 

A personal care attendant is a caregiver that provides various personal care services in accordance with an established plan of care and provides for the personal needs and comfort of clients in their homes throughout Marin County, California.

Responsibilities for Personal Care Caregivers

 

·       Performs personal care activities that assist the client with activities of daily living 

·       Performs housekeeping activities (light laundry, dishes, basic upkeep of home)

·       Performs client-specific activities (medication reminders, range of motion exercises)

 

Qualifications for Personal Care Caregivers

 

·       At least 1 year of personal care caregiving experience required

·       Have access to adequate transportation to get to and from the job

·       Possess a valid driver's license if transporting clients or running errands for clients

·       Ability to read, write, speak and understand English as needed for the job
